Phylogenetic analysis and domain characteristics of Bmpr2 in ricefield eel, Monopterus albus . ( A ), The phylogenetic tree was researched by the neighbor-joining algorithm of Mega 11. The phylogeny was tested using the bootstrap method with 1000 replications. The numbers at nodes are bootstrap values (%). M. albus is marked in bold. The Bmpr2 protein sequences of vertebrates were obtained from Entrez (NCBI). ( B ), The characteristic Bmpr2 domains are conserved in ricefield eel orthologues. Bmpr2 is conservative in ligand-binding domain (ActRI/ActRII domain) and kinase domain, while the kinase domain is more conserved in Bmpr2. Numbers represent percentage identity of the predicted protein sequences with other type II BMP receptor orthologues (hBMPR2— Homo sapiens BMPR2, rBMPR2— Rattus BMPR2, gBMPR2— Gallus BMPR2, xBMPR2— Xenopus tropicalis BMPR2, mBmpr2— Micropterus salmoides Bmpr2b, sBmpr2— Scatophagus argus Bmpr2b, dBmpr2a— Danio rerio Bmpr2a, and dBmpr2b— Danio rerio Bmpr2b).
